Try uninstalling IE 7.0. You can do so by finding it in Control Panel/Add
and Remove programs and being sure to check show updates. I don't know
offhand why you are having a problem but if IE6 works you may want to stick
with it. Some applications or combination of applications do not seem to
work well with IE7.
